Modular hotels are hotels constructed using prefabricated modular units that are manufactured off-site and assembled on location.This construction method allows hotel developments to be delivered faster, with greater cost certainty and improved quality control compared to traditional building approaches.
The hospitality sector is increasingly exploring modular construction due to a combination of structural pressures:
Shortage of skilled construction labor
Rising construction and financing costs
Long development timelines affecting ROI
Sustainability and ESG requirements
Increasing demand for urban and infill hotel projects
Modular construction addresses several of these challenges simultaneously.
A modular hotel typically involves:
Volumetric or hybrid modular construction
Factory-manufactured hotel rooms or room sections
On-site assembly into a permanent building
Compliance with local building codes and hotel brand standards
What a modular hotel is not
Temporary accommodation
Shipping container hotels
Prefabricated bathrooms only
Low-quality or short-lifespan structures
Commonly cited advantages of modular hotels include:
Reduced construction time
Predictable project costs
Improved quality control
Reduced material waste
Lower on-site disruption
Earlier revenue generation

Modular hotels are currently in an early-to-growth adoption phase.
Adoption varies by region
Supply chains are still maturing
Large hotel brands are experimenting with modular delivery models
Developers are increasingly considering modular construction for repeatable room typologies
The concept is established, but not yet fully standardized across the industry.
As construction and hospitality models continue to converge, modular hotels are expected to become more common.Their adoption will likely be driven by economics, sustainability targets and the need for faster project delivery rather than design novelty.
